Accessible Ramp Construction in Wilmington, NC
Accessible ramp construction services provide solutions for creating safe, functional, and compliant ramps that improve property accessibility for individuals with mobility challenges. These services cover a variety of projects, including residential entrances, commercial storefronts, and multi-unit housing, ensuring that doorways, patios, and pathways can be easily navigated by wheelchair users, those with walkers, or anyone needing additional support. Property owners typically want to understand the materials used, the design options available, and how the ramps will integrate with existing structures to meet safety and accessibility standards.
Before requesting accessible ramp construction, property owners often consider factors such as the location where the ramp will be installed, the slope or incline required for safe use, and any local building codes or regulations that must be followed. It's also helpful to think about the overall aesthetic and how the ramp will complement the property's appearance. Clear communication about these considerations can help ensure the finished project meets both functional needs and personal preferences.

Common Accessible Ramp Construction Jobs
Residential ramp installations - customized ramps designed to improve accessibility for homes and entryways.
Commercial ramp construction - durable ramps that meet accessibility standards for businesses and public spaces.
Portable ramp solutions - temporary or removable ramps for events, renovations, or short-term needs.
Wheelchair ramp upgrades - modifications and extensions to existing ramps for enhanced safety and usability.
Outdoor accessible ramps - weather-resistant ramps suitable for gardens, patios, and outdoor entry points.
Indoor ramp projects - seamless ramps that provide smooth transitions inside homes for mobility assistance.
Accessible Ramp Construction Questions
What types of ramps are available for accessibility? Several options include portable, modular, and custom-built ramps to suit different property needs and terrain.
What materials are used in ramp construction?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and composite, chosen for durability and safety.
Are ramps suitable for all property types? Ramps can be designed for residential, commercial, and public spaces to improve accessibility.
What should property owners consider when planning a ramp? Consider the location, slope requirements, and available space to ensure safe and functional access.
